And The Wind Whispered 'Mary' ~*Marge Tindal*~ On a night long ago, Wind came calling out 'Mary' - knew her by name Blew across the barren plains in a land so very far away Found 'Mary' sheltered safe inside a stable in the countryside Saw Joseph standing by his bride in wait of a miracle yet to be born Gently, Wind buffeted about in awe at the vision of the star he saw Rising in the sky without flaw Shining brightly in celestial adorn From within the stable bare came a mewing breath of air that the Child of God would wear to teach the world to sing in mirth Suddenly Wind began to claim 'Mary'-'Mary' blessed is thy name Blew in gusts, then he came to spread the news of Jesus' birth Wind summoned angels in to see as the Babe lay so quietly Cradled ever so gently in the lap of 'Mary' 'Mary' smiled at Wind and said This Babe now sleeps in manger bed You've warmly blown upon His head Wind wept tears in gentle shed at the compassionate glory of 'Mary' So if upon this eve so bright you should hear Wind tonight Listen closely, you will hear so dearly 'Mary'-'Mary' praised on Wind so clearly *A repost from PiP Open Forum #17 ...
